Limits and quotas for the Ladlefox recipe-scaling calculator, for support reference. Free tier: 20 scalings per day, recipes capped at 40 ingredients. Paid tier: unlimited scalings, 200 ingredients. Scaling factors outside the allowed range are rejected with a validation error, not silently clamped — customers often report this as a bug. Batch conversions count each recipe separately against the daily quota. The enforced numeric limits are defined in config as shown below.

tuning table, kajog-kawef:
PRIORITIES = {
    "kelox": 870,
    "kasix": 89,
    "eliax": 988,
}

## Changelog — Font vendoring defaults changed

As of this release, the Bracken UI build no longer fetches third-party fonts at build time. All typefaces used by the Lanternwell suite are now vendored into the repo under a dedicated assets directory, and the fetch step is skipped by default. If you're onboarding, nothing to install — the fonts travel with the checkout. The build flags controlling this behavior are listed below.

settings of hadup-yafog:
LAMAEL_PIN=3761
LAMAEL_TENANT=istmir
LAMAEL_METRICS_HOST=metrics.lamael.plorvasys.test
LAMAEL_SEAL=seal_8ea68500
LAMAEL_STANDBY_TEAM=fraok

Subject: Contrast audit results — Paletteer 4.2

Plugin authors: the Brightgate accessibility audit flagged low-contrast defaults in several third-party themes. Paletteer 4.2 enforces a minimum contrast ratio at render time; non-compliant plugins will see overridden colors. Test against the new build before Friday's cutover. Questions go to the theming channel. The release build identifier you should pin is below.

pipeline stamp: htk9_6ce9d33c5

## Sensor drift: what to do at 3am

If the GrowLoop controller starts reporting humidity swings that don't match the backup probes in the Fernwick greenhouse, it's almost always sensor drift, not an actual climate event. Don't panic and don't touch the vents manually. First, restart the calibration daemon and give it ten minutes to re-baseline. If readings still disagree by more than 5%, flip the controller into safe mode. The safe-mode thresholds it will use are these.

config for yahap-bajof:
[istix]
host = istix.qorvelsys.internal
user = istix_svc
database = istix_prod